Chinese Solar Manufacturers Oppose US Trade Probe

The US Commerce Department started investigating the trade practices of Chinese solar panel companies earlier this month.

SolarWorld Industries and other American solar panel makers had accused Chinese manufacturers of selling solar panels below cost in the US, with the help of illegal subsidies from the Chinese government.

Now Chinese solar panel companies are saying their success in the US market comes down to their own competitive advantages. And the Chinese regime has announced its own retaliatory investigation into US government subsidies of renewable energy.

But despite the controversy, Chinese firms say they don't want to start a trade war with the US. And US Ambassador to China Gary Locke says the investigations only affect a few percentage points of trade.

US solar panel imports from China rose to $1.5 billion last year, up from $640 million in 2009.
